Lokhu futhi kukhombisa izinkinga zokuxhumeka kwe-WiFi: ukubambezeleka okuphezulu kanye nokungazinzi, okusobala kakhulu uma kwenzeka kubasebenzisi abaningi ngesikhathi esisodwa, kodwa lesi simo sizothuthuka kakhulu ngokufika kwe-WiFi 6. Lokhu kungenxa yokuthi i-WiFi 5, esetshenziswa abantu abaningi, isebenzisa ubuchwepheshe be-OFDM, kuyilapho i-WiFi 6 isebenzisa ubuchwepheshe be-OFDMA. Umehluko phakathi kwalezi zindlela ezimbili ungaboniswa ngemidwebo:

Emgwaqweni ONGAKWAZI ukwamukela imoto eyodwa kuphela, i-OFDMA ingadlulisela ama-terminal amaningi ngasikhathi sinye, isuse imigqa nokuminyana, ITHUTHUKISA UKUSEBENZA KAHLE FUTHI IYEHLISE ukubambezeleka. I-OFDMA ihlukanisa isiteshi esingenantambo sibe yiziteshi eziningi ezincane kusizinda semvamisa, ukuze abasebenzisi abaningi bakwazi ukudlulisa idatha ngasikhathi sinye ngesikhathi ngasinye, okuthuthukisa ukusebenza kahle futhi kunciphisa ukubambezeleka kokumiswa komugqa.

I-WIFI 6 ibilokhu ithandwa kakhulu selokhu yasungulwa, njengoba abantu befuna amanethiwekhi asekhaya angenantambo amaningi. Ama-terminal e-Wi-Fi 6 angaphezu kwezigidigidi ezimbili athunyelwe ekupheleni kuka-2021, okwenza kube ngaphezu kuka-50% wazo zonke izimpahla ze-Wi-Fi, futhi lelo nani lizokhula lifinyelele ku-5.2 billion ngo-2025, ngokusho kwenkampani yokuhlaziya i-IDC.

Nakuba i-Wi-Fi 6 igxile kokuhlangenwe nakho komsebenzisi ezimweni ezinabantu abaningi, kuye kwavela izinhlelo zokusebenza ezintsha eminyakeni yamuva nje ezidinga i-throughput ephezulu kanye nokubambezeleka, njengevidiyo ye-ultra-high-definition efana namavidiyo e-4K kanye ne-8K, ukusebenza kude, i-video conferencing eku-inthanethi, kanye nemidlalo ye-VR/AR. Izinkampani ezinkulu zobuchwepheshe nazo ziyazibona lezi zinkinga, kanti i-Wi-Fi 7, enikeza isivinini esikhulu, umthamo ophezulu kanye nokubambezeleka okuphansi, iyaqhubeka. Ake sithathe i-Wi-Fi 7 ye-Qualcomm njengesibonelo futhi sixoxe ngalokho i-Wi-Fi 7 ekuthuthukisile.

I-Wi-fi 7: Konke ngenxa ye-Low Latency

1. I-bandwidth Ephakeme

Futhi, thatha imigwaqo. I-Wi-fi 6 isekela kakhulu amabhendi angu-2.4ghz kanye no-5ghz, kodwa umgwaqo ongu-2.4ghz wabelwa yi-Wi-Fi yakuqala kanye nezinye ubuchwepheshe obungenantambo njenge-Bluetooth, ngakho-ke uba matasa kakhulu. Imigwaqo engu-5GHz ibanzi futhi ayixinene kakhulu kune-2.4ghz, okuhunyushwa ngesivinini esisheshayo kanye nomthamo owengeziwe. I-Wi-fi 7 isekela ngisho nebhendi engu-6GHz phezu kwala mabhendi amabili, yandisa ububanzi besiteshi esisodwa kusukela ku-Wi-Fi 6's 160MHz kuya ku-320MHz (engathwala izinto eziningi ngesikhathi). Ngaleso sikhathi, i-Wi-Fi 7 izoba nesilinganiso sokudlulisa esiphezulu esingaphezu kuka-40Gbps, esiphindwe kane kune-Wi-Fi 6E.

2. Ukufinyelela kwezixhumanisi eziningi

Ngaphambi kwe-Wi-Fi 7, abasebenzisi babesebenzisa umgwaqo owodwa kuphela ofanela izidingo zabo, kodwa isixazululo se-Qualcomm's Wi-Fi 7 sidlula imingcele ye-Wi-Fi nakakhulu: esikhathini esizayo, wonke ama-band amathathu azokwazi ukusebenza ngesikhathi esisodwa, okunciphisa ukuminyana. Ngaphezu kwalokho, ngokusekelwe kumsebenzi we-multi-link, abasebenzisi bangaxhuma ngeziteshi eziningi, besebenzisa lokhu ukuze bagweme ukuminyana. Isibonelo, uma kukhona ithrafikhi kwesinye seziteshi, idivayisi ingasebenzisa esinye isiteshi, okuholela ekubambezelekeni okuphansi. Okwamanje, kuye ngokutholakala kwezifunda ezahlukene, i-multi-link ingasebenzisa iziteshi ezimbili kubhendi ye-5GHz noma inhlanganisela yeziteshi ezimbili kubhendi ye-5GHz ne-6GHz.

3. Isiteshi Esihlanganisiwe

Njengoba kushiwo ngenhla, i-bandwidth ye-Wi-Fi 7 inyuswe yaba yi-320MHz (ububanzi bemoto). Ku-band ye-5GHz, ayikho i-band eqhubekayo ye-320MHz, ngakho-ke yisifunda se-6GHz kuphela esingasekela le modi eqhubekayo. Ngomsebenzi we-multi-link ohambisanayo we-bandwidth ephezulu, ama-frequency band amabili angahlanganiswa ngesikhathi esisodwa ukuze kuqoqwe i-throughput yeziteshi ezimbili, okungukuthi, amasignali amabili e-160MHz angahlanganiswa ukuze kwakhiwe isiteshi esisebenzayo se-320MHz (ububanzi obunwetshiwe). Ngale ndlela, izwe elifana nelethu, elingakabelani i-spectrum ye-6GHz, lingahlinzeka nangesiteshi esibanzi ngokwanele esisebenzayo ukuze kufezwe i-throughput ephezulu kakhulu ezimweni ezixinene.

4. 4K QAM

Ukuguqulwa kwe-oda okuphezulu kakhulu kwe-Wi-Fi 6 yi-1024-QAM, kanti i-Wi-Fi 7 ingafinyelela ku-4K QAM. Ngale ndlela, izinga eliphakeme kakhulu lingakhushulwa ukuze kwandiswe umthamo wokudlulisa kanye nedatha, futhi ijubane lokugcina lingafinyelela ku-30Gbps, okuyisivinini esiphindwe kathathu kune-9.6Gbps WiFi 6 yamanje.

Ngamafuphi, i-Wi-Fi 7 yenzelwe ukuhlinzeka ngesivinini esikhulu kakhulu, umthamo ophezulu, kanye nokudluliswa kwedatha okuphansi ngokwandisa inani lemizila etholakalayo, ububanzi bemoto ngayinye ethutha idatha, kanye nobubanzi bomzila ohambayo.

I-Wi-fi 7 Ivula Indlela Ye-IoT Enesivinini Esikhulu Exhunywe Kaningi

Ngokombono wombhali, ingqikithi yobuchwepheshe obusha be-Wi-Fi 7 akukhona nje ukuthuthukisa izinga eliphezulu ledivayisi eyodwa, kodwa futhi nokunaka kakhulu ukudluliswa kwejubane eliphezulu ngesikhathi esisodwa ngaphansi kokusetshenziswa kwezimo zabasebenzisi abaningi (ukufinyelela kwemizila eminingi), okungangabazeki ukuthi kuhambisana nenkathi ezayo ye-Internet of Things. Okulandelayo, umbhali uzokhuluma ngezimo ze-iot ezizuzisa kakhulu:

1. I-inthanethi Yezinto Zezimboni

Enye yezingqinamba ezinkulu zobuchwepheshe be-iot ekukhiqizeni i-bandwidth. Uma idatha eminingi ingadluliselwa ngesikhathi esisodwa, i-Iiot izoba ngokushesha futhi isebenze kahle kakhulu. Endabeni yokuqapha ikhwalithi ku-Industrial Internet of Things, isivinini senethiwekhi sibalulekile empumelelweni yezinhlelo zokusebenza zesikhathi sangempela. Ngosizo lwenethiwekhi ye-Iiot esheshayo, izexwayiso zesikhathi sangempela zingathunyelwa ngesikhathi ukuze kuphendulwe ngokushesha ezinkingeni ezifana nokwehluleka kwemishini okungalindelekile nokunye ukuphazamiseka, okuthuthukisa kakhulu umkhiqizo kanye nokusebenza kahle kwamabhizinisi okukhiqiza kanye nokunciphisa izindleko ezingadingekile.

2. Ikhompyutha Yomphetho

Njengoba isidingo sabantu sokuphendula okusheshayo kwemishini ehlakaniphile kanye nokuphepha kwedatha kwe-Intanethi Yezinto kukhuphuka kakhulu, i-cloud computing izothambekela ekuncishweni isikhathi esizayo. I-Edge computing imane ibhekisela ekubaleni ohlangothini lomsebenzisi, okudinga hhayi nje amandla aphezulu ekubaleni ohlangothini lomsebenzisi, kodwa futhi nesivinini sokudlulisa idatha esiphezulu ngokwanele ohlangothini lomsebenzisi.

3. I-AR/VR ejulile

I-VR ejulile idinga ukwenza impendulo esheshayo ehambisanayo ngokwezenzo zabadlali ngesikhathi sangempela, okudinga ukubambezeleka okuphansi kakhulu kwenethiwekhi. Uma uhlala unikeza abadlali impendulo emfushane, khona-ke ukucwilisa kuyinkohliso. I-Wi-fi 7 kulindeleke ukuthi ixazulule le nkinga futhi isheshise ukwamukelwa kwe-AR/VR ejulile.

4. Ukuphepha okuhlakaniphile

Ngokuthuthuka kokuphepha okuhlakaniphile, isithombe esidluliselwa ngamakhamera ahlakaniphile siya ngokuya siba nencazelo ephezulu, okusho ukuthi idatha enamandla edluliselwayo iya ngokuya iba nkulu, kanti nezidingo ze-bandwidth kanye nesivinini senethiwekhi nazo ziya ngokuya ziphakama. Ku-LAN, i-WIFI 7 cishe iyindlela engcono kakhulu.

Ekugcineni

I-Wi-fi 7 ilungile, kodwa okwamanje, amazwe abonisa imibono ehlukene yokuthi kufanele yini avumele ukufinyelela kwe-WiFi kubhendi ye-6GHz (5925-7125mhz) njengebhendi engenalayisensi. Izwe alikakanikezi inqubomgomo ecacile ku-6GHz, kodwa noma ngabe kutholakala ibhendi ye-5GHz kuphela, i-Wi-Fi 7 isengakwazi ukunikeza izinga eliphezulu lokudlulisa elingu-4.3Gbps, kuyilapho i-Wi-Fi 6 isekela kuphela isivinini sokulanda esiphezulu esingu-3Gbps uma ibhendi ye-6GHz itholakala. Ngakho-ke, kulindeleke ukuthi i-Wi-Fi 7 izodlala indima ebaluleke kakhulu kuma-Lans asheshayo esikhathini esizayo, isize amadivayisi amaningi ahlakaniphile ukuthi agweme ukubanjwa yikhebula.
